Transaction 75eb29f25a91b46711de457900a113c10528d8900c658527ce88fc89a52202a9

2 Input
2 Outputs
  • 75eb29f25a91b46711de457900a113c10528d8900c658527ce88fc89a52202a9:0
  • value  653544
    address  1Ndy9xGzjP2KTyYnAAtnGVM4MK1w34hoXV
  • 75eb29f25a91b46711de457900a113c10528d8900c658527ce88fc89a52202a9:1
  • value  1524935
    address  12yS7LrQm5r63tSeNHSq1NMmhSBPWnrLDS